    Introduction: The Metric System vs. the Imperial System

    The world uses two primary systems of measurement: the metric system (also known as the International System of Units or SI) and the imperial system. The metric system is a decimal system, meaning it's based on powers of 10, making conversions relatively straightforward. The imperial system, on the other hand, uses a variety of units with less intuitive relationships, often requiring complex conversion factors. Kilograms and pounds are units of mass in these respective systems. A kilogram is the base unit of mass in the metric system, while the pound is a unit of mass in the imperial system, historically derived from the weight of a specific volume of water. Understanding the difference and the conversion factor between these units is fundamental to bridging the gap between these systems.

    The Conversion Factor: Kilograms to Pounds and Vice Versa

    The fundamental conversion factor is approximately 2.20462 pounds per kilogram. This means that one kilogram is equal to approximately 2.20462 pounds. Conversely, one pound is approximately equal to 0.453592 kilograms. While these are the precise conversion factors, in many everyday situations, rounding to 2.2 pounds per kilogram is sufficient for practical purposes.

    The exact conversion factor arises from the official definitions of both the kilogram and the pound. The kilogram was originally defined based on the mass of a platinum-iridium cylinder, though it now has a more fundamental definition based on Planck's constant. The pound's definition is historically rooted in the weight of a specific volume of water, but its modern definition is ultimately tied to the kilogram through the conversion factor.

    Practical Applications of the Kilogram to Pound Conversion

    Understanding this conversion has numerous practical applications:

    • Cooking and Baking: Many international recipes are published using metric units (kilograms and grams). Being able to convert these measurements to pounds and ounces is essential for accurate baking and cooking. For example, a recipe calling for 1 kg of flour would require approximately 2.2 lbs of flour.

    • Shopping and Purchasing: When comparing prices or weights of goods from different countries or vendors, you need to convert the units to a common standard for accurate comparison. This is particularly important when purchasing goods online from international retailers. If you're comparing the price of a 5 kg bag of rice to a 10 lb bag, understanding the conversion helps determine which is the better value.

    • Shipping and Logistics: In international shipping, weights are often specified in kilograms or pounds. Accurate conversion is necessary to ensure correct labeling and calculation of shipping costs. Incorrect conversion can lead to delays, additional charges, and even rejected shipments.

    • Scientific Research and Engineering: Accurate conversions are critical in scientific research and engineering applications that involve measurements from different countries or using a mix of metric and imperial units. Maintaining consistency in measurements is essential to ensure the reliability and reproducibility of experimental results.

    • Healthcare and Medicine: While healthcare increasingly uses metric units, understanding the conversion between kilograms and pounds is still relevant, especially when dealing with patient records from different regions or comparing data from different studies. For instance, converting a patient's weight from pounds to kilograms is essential for accurate dosage calculations of medications.

    Common Misconceptions and Errors

    Several misconceptions surround the kilogram to pound conversion:

    • Using a rounded conversion factor inappropriately: While using 2.2 lbs/kg is generally acceptable for everyday purposes, it's crucial to use the more precise conversion factor in scientific or engineering contexts where accuracy is paramount. The small difference can accumulate and lead to significant errors in calculations.

    • Confusing kilograms and grams: Remember that 1 kilogram equals 1000 grams. Don't forget to convert grams to kilograms before using the kilogram-to-pound conversion factor.

    • Ignoring significant figures: Pay attention to significant figures when doing conversions. The number of significant figures in your final answer should be consistent with the least precise measurement used in the calculation.

    • Not considering the context: The meaning of the "pound" can vary slightly based on the context, and there's a subtle difference between the "avoirdupois pound" (common in everyday use) and the "troy pound" (used for precious metals). This distinction rarely impacts everyday conversions, but it’s useful to be aware of.

    Frequently Asked Questions (FAQs)

    • Q: How do I convert pounds to kilograms?

      • A: Multiply the weight in pounds by 0.453592 to get the equivalent weight in kilograms.
    • Q: How many pounds are in 5 kilograms?

      • A: 5 kg * 2.20462 lbs/kg ≈ 11.023 lbs
    • Q: Is it okay to use 2.2 lbs/kg for all conversions?

      • A: While acceptable for many everyday applications, using the more precise conversion factor (2.20462 lbs/kg) is recommended for accuracy, particularly in scientific or engineering applications.
    • Q: What is the difference between mass and weight?

      • A: Mass is the amount of matter in an object, while weight is the force of gravity acting on that mass.
